I’ve also come across a new start up company called Be Right Back who are the first surprise travel subscription service. I think it’s such an amazing concept for gift giving and prices start at from £199 for a one-off surprise weekend trip to Europe, £399 for 2 trips and £599 for a subscription to 3 trips in a year. It’s really easy to personalise the subscription based on the recipients taste and preferences. How amazing would this be to receive a trip like this on Christmas Day?
Finally, I want to mention a very practical item which is The Travel Hack Suitcase. Fellow travel blogger Monica from The Travel Hack has released her own suitcase which just looks like the absolute dream. Not only is it super stylish with rose gold detailing, it’s so practical with compartments for your laptop. It also has it’s very own integrated handbag compartment so there will be no messing about if you’re flying hand luggage only.
